As the senior English archery and sports-betting editor for SaskArchery.com, this independent ranking identifies sportsbook operators that (a) support Google Pay as a deposit option in at least some regulated markets and (b) have reliably shown archery markets (usually around major events such as the Olympics, World Cups or World Championships). Archery betting is intermittent at most books — expect markets to appear mainly for Olympic, World Archery and selected continental events. This guide focuses on practical suitability for archery bettors: archery market availability, niche-sports depth, live betting when available, mobile/UX for in-play archery, Google Pay support and regulatory practicality.

Detailed operator notes (evidence, limitations, suitability for archery bettors)

bet365 — top pick for event-driven archery bettors

Why it’s listed: bet365 publicly documents Google Pay among its cashier options in many regions and maintains a dedicated archery rules page, which demonstrates the operator treats archery as a recognised market when events are offered. (help.bet365.com)

  • Archery coverage: bet365 has an archery rules page and historically priced Olympic and World Archery markets (individual medals, team medals, match winners). That rules page is evidence the operator will settle archery markets according to standard event scoring when they list them. (help.bet365.com)
  • Google Pay: bet365 lists Google Pay on its payments/deposit help pages for supported markets — making deposits fast for mobile users. Verify availability after login since local regulation and account history affect which payment buttons appear. (help.bet365.com)
  • In-play: bet365 has strong live-betting infrastructure; however archery in-play markets are event-dependent and are most often opened during elimination stages of big championships (Olympics, World Cup finals). Expect some matches to be offered in-play, but don’t assume round‑by‑round pricing is always present.
  • Limitations: availability varies by country and sometimes Google Pay is deposit-only (withdrawals follow the operator’s closed-loop rules). Always confirm the cashier in your logged-in account before depositing for an archery market.
  • Suitability for archery bettors: Excellent for pre-match medal and outright markets and useful during Olympics/World events for in-play if bet365 opens those lines.
